Textural Approach to Palmprint Identification (1210.6192v1)

Published 23 Oct 2012 in cs.CV, cs.CR, and cs.GR

Abstract: Biometrics which use of human physiological characteristics for identifying an individual is now a widespread method of identification and authentication. Biometric identification is a technology which uses several image processing techniques and describes the general procedure for identification and verification using feature extraction, storage and matching from the digitized image of biometric characters such as Finger Print, Face, Iris or Palm Print. The current paper uses palm print biometrics. Here we have presented an identification approach using textural properties of palm print images. The elegance of the method is that the conventional edge detection technique is extended to suitably describe the texture features. In this technique all the characteristics of the palm such as principal lines, edges and wrinkles are considered with equal importance.
